C语言库函数详解,语法、用法及示例实战指南
摘要:
本文介绍了C语言中库函数的详细解析,包括语法和用法,通过具体示例,深入探讨了这些库函数在实际编程中的应用,这些库函数提供了丰富的功能,如字符串处理、文件操作、数学计算等,极大地丰富了C语言的开发功能,本文旨在帮助读者更好地理解库函数的使用,提高编程效率和准确性。
本文介绍了C语言中的库函数,包括其定义、语法和用法,文章详细解释了库函数的含义及其在C语言程序中的作用,同时提供了示例代码以展示如何使用这些函数,通过学习和理解库函数的语法和用法,开发者可以更加高效地编写C语言程序,利用库函数实现各种功能,提高编程效率和代码质量。
《C语言中strcpy函数的使用方法》
在C语言中,strcpy函数用于将一个字符串复制到另一个字符串中,该函数定义在string.h头文件中,是标准库函数之一,以下是关于strcpy函数用法的详细说明:
- 基本用法: strcpy函数的原型是char strcpy(char dest, const char *src);,其中dest是目标字符串,src是源字符串,该函数将src所指向的字符串复制到dest所指向的位置。
- 注意事项: 使用strcpy函数时,需要确保目标字符串有足够的空间来存储要复制的字符串,否则可能会导致缓冲区溢出错误,strcpy函数不会添加空字符('\0')到目标字符串的末尾,因此在使用完strcpy后需要手动添加空字符以确保字符串的正确终止。
- 示例代码: 以下是一个简单的示例程序,演示了如何使用strcpy函数将字符串从一个数组复制到另一个数组:
#include <stdio.h> #include <string.h> int main() { char a[50]; // 定义目标字符串数组 char b[] = "Hello, World!"; // 定义源字符串 strcpy(a, b); // 使用strcpy函数复制字符串 printf("目标字符串:%s\n", a); // 打印复制后的目标字符串 return 0; }
输出结果将是:"目标字符串:Hello, World!",通过上面的示例,你可以看到strcpy函数的基本用法和效果,希望以上内容对你有所帮助!